Transaction 21c9f18fcb4c1961c9d42acee44f957d6786698c67078d0f48f68b68dbbf3378
2 Input
2 Outputs
- 21c9f18fcb4c1961c9d42acee44f957d6786698c67078d0f48f68b68dbbf3378:0
- 21c9f18fcb4c1961c9d42acee44f957d6786698c67078d0f48f68b68dbbf3378:1
value 4186178675
address 3MGZHzPDiY7FT3yhefZxmS7SorCdhxsMNr
value 1325389741
address 38i56KuQ3UHMbAHVUxBDXXxNXndHtdAyRd